How they compare
Greece currently reports 0.2 LSU/ha against 0.02 LSU/ha in Central America, a difference of 0.18 LSU/ha.
That makes Greece's figure about 10.0 times Central America's.
Across all 63 years both countries report, Greece has been ahead every year.
Central America ranks 22nd and Greece ranks 25th of 31 groups.
Greece has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Central America | Greece |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 0.0122 LSU/ha | 0.14 LSU/ha | 0.1278 LSU/ha | Greece |
| 1970s | 0.01 LSU/ha | 0.136 LSU/ha | 0.126 LSU/ha | Greece |
| 1980s | 0.012 LSU/ha | 0.142 LSU/ha | 0.13 LSU/ha | Greece |
| 1990s | 0.01 LSU/ha | 0.156 LSU/ha | 0.146 LSU/ha | Greece |
| 2000s | 0.01 LSU/ha | 0.18 LSU/ha | 0.17 LSU/ha | Greece |
| 2010s | 0.019 LSU/ha | 0.201 LSU/ha | 0.182 LSU/ha | Greece |
| 2020s | 0.02 LSU/ha | 0.1925 LSU/ha | 0.1725 LSU/ha | Greece |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The Livestock Patterns domain of FAOSTAT contains data on livestock numbers, shares of major livestock species and densities of livestock units in the agricultural land area. Values are calculated using Livestock Units (LSU), which facilitate aggregating information for different livestock types. Data are available by country, with global coverage, for the period 1961 to the most recent year available with annual updates. This methodology applies the LSU coefficients reported in the "Guidelines for the preparation of livestock sector reviews" (FAO, 2011). From this publication, LSU coefficients are computed by livestock type and by country. The reference unit used for the calculation of livestock units (=1 LSU) is the grazing equivalent of one adult dairy cow producing 3000 kg of milk annually, fed without additional concentrated foodstuffs. FAOSTAT agri-environmental indicators on livestock patterns closely follow the structure of the indicators in EUROSTAT.
